Nigerian Army personnel lament suffering and neglect after being injured and wounded in action, raising serious concerns about welfare, medical care, and support for soldiers who risk their lives in active operations. This report highlights the voices of wounded personnel who say they were abandoned after sustaining injuries while defending the nation, sparking debate about accountability and responsibility within the system.
